I had a motor just like yours, with the same problems. Mine was getting so hot it melted the brush plate. After the third time i just told landry to send it back to minnkota. I wrote them a letter stating, "i know i am not kevin vandam but i feel this should be fixed. I was just asking for credit to buy another unit. Landry explained it good. He told me the problem is they are using plastic parts in the 70lb units not the brass parts like alll the others. These are not capable of handling the heat created. So when i spoke with a minkota spokesman he stated the units are not made to run on 3-5 for long periods of time. I asked him then why have those speeds and he could not answer. Nonetheless i sent the unit to them. After a few days i called them. They guy told me my unit was ready and about to be sent back to me. I asked him if he read my letter and he stated he wasn't the person who fixed my unit and he transfered me to the person who did. When i talk with tim he said he just read the letter and i pretty mush had sent him a new unit with all the work landry had done. We talked for awhile and i told him how popular they are here and how i would not like to give them free negative advertisement and i just wanted a credit to buy another unit. He said don't worry we will make it right. A few days later the ups man showed up with a huge box. In it was a new 80lb minn kota with a gas lever system. I was very impressed. The only thing i have done to it since is had landry put me a shorter shaft because it was too long for my aluminum boat.
